  • What kinds of damages can a brain injury victim recover in a successful claim in Tulsa?

    Brain injury victims or their families in Tulsa can demand compensation for economic and non-economic damages. Economic damages include medical expenses, lost wages or diminished earning capacity, and property damage. Non-economic damages, on the other hand, include the pain, suffering, emotional trauma, and reduced quality of life that victims experience due to the incident that caused their brain injury.

  • What happens if the other party claims that a brain injury victim in Tulsa is partially at fault for the incident?

    If the other party claims that the brain injury victim is partially to blame for the incident, then comparative negligence would be at play in the case. Therefore, the victim's claim value may be reduced proportionally to their degree of responsibility. There is also the possibility that the victim would not receive anything. In Tulsa and other parts of Oklahoma, if the brain injury victim is found over 50% at fault, they are barred from recovering any damages.

  • How long does a brain injury victim in Tulsa have to file a claim against the at-fault party?

    In Tulsa, brain injury and other personal injury cases must be filed within two years from the incident date. This period is established to maintain the integrity of the evidence and prevent plaintiffs from threatening defendants with a lawsuit as long as they would want to. Some exceptions to this statute of limitations are wrongful death and medical malpractice.

  • How long does a brain injury case in Tulsa usually take to be finalized?

    The resolution of brain injury cases in Tulsa is between 18 months and three years. Cases are dragged out in negotiations and litigations by insurance companies. Working with a lawyer with experience in handling personal injury cases can help ensure that the case progresses on time, reducing the financial burden on the victim and their family.
